The Department of Education has set some clear guidelines for those students who will have a tough time to qualify for loans. If you are incarcerated, have a conviction for a drug offense or will be participating in a mandatory civil commitment after being incarcerated for a sexual offense, federal student aid will be very limited. In order to stay eligible for student aid, a student will need to keep their academics in good standing and fill out a FAFSA every year. Parents with dependent children will need to include their financial information in order for the student to qualify. The student will lose eligibility if they are convicted of a drug offense. For those who would like to return to school, in order to qualify for financial aid, their prior loans must not be in default. Non US citizens with 'green cards' are eligible for student loans if all other basic criteria is met. These 'eligible noncitizens' are treated no different when applying for student loans. The obtaining relief process is not as simple, especially if you have different types of federal loans. Keep private and federal loans separate when looking for relief. Private lenders will include federal debt into a consolidation loan, but private loans will not receive federal benefits. Don't miss out.
